Learning Objectives
Define hospice care and summarize its primary goals.
Identify eligibility requirements for hospice care and describe financial coverage options.
Describe hospice services and differentiate the roles of healthcare team members involved in hospice care.
Describe the purpose of palliative care and compare common methods used to deliver it.
Explain prevailing cultural and religious attitudes toward death and dying and explain how these attitudes may influence end-of-life care preferences.
